Moew Forecasts Flash Floods, Rising River Levels In Parts Of Afghanistan
In a statement issued today (Sunday), the ministry said relatively heavy rainfall accompanied by possible flash floods was forecast in parts of the Kabul river basin and some of its tributaries from September 14 to 16.
The statement said flooding and rising water levels were also possible along rivers in Khost, Paktia, Logar, Maidan Wardak, Kapisa, Nangarhar, Laghman, Kunar and Nuristan provinces, as well as in some tributaries of these rivers.
The ministry urged residents of downstream areas to avoid approaching riverbanks during flooding or when water levels rise.
The ministry also called on residents of upstream areas to promptly alert people in downstream areas if floods occur or river water levels rise, in order to prevent loss of life and financial losses.
